Avdotyino (Russian: Авдотьино) is a rural locality (a selo) in Aksinyinskoye Rural Settlement of Aksinyinskoye Rural Settlement, Stupinsky District, Moscow Oblast, Russia. The population was 75 as of 2010.[2] There are 4 streets.
Geography[]
The khutor is located between rivers Kononkova and Severka, 49 km north of Stupino (the district's administrative centre) by road. Bolshoye Alexeyevskoye is the nearest rural locality.[3]
